Output bb8e891675391d3218b28fd62dba88b65d999db8d692ce8f42a4154c3c1a99a4:2

value
2701429
script pubkey
OP_0 OP_PUSHBYTES_20 685f33fb91f6356ae9ea5bb32400f996ca6b0dde
address
bc1qdp0n87u37c6k4602twejgq8ejm9xkrw70v8qnh
transaction
bb8e891675391d3218b28fd62dba88b65d999db8d692ce8f42a4154c3c1a99a4
confirmations
199210
spent
true